Poor housing design and not higher insulation standards lead New Zealand households to increasingly feel the heat over summer.The Building Research Association of NZ (Branz) said homes need to be considered a system rather than a set of individual components.Its comments were in response to proposed changes to higher insulation standards for new builds, which were only introduced in November 2023.Branz has just published a new survey showing homes of all ages overheat in the summer months.Unintended consequencesThe Ministry of Business, Innovat...
